Demystifying the Math Behind 15 Times 6
At its simplest level, multiplication is just repeated addition. When we look at 15 Times 6, we are essentially asking what the total is when we add the number 15 to itself six times. While many of us memorized these tables through repetition in grade school, there are various mental math strategies that make reaching the solution of 90 both faster and more intuitive.
To break down the calculation, consider these different approaches:
- The Decomposition Method: Break the number 15 into 10 and 5. Multiply each by 6 (10 x 6 = 60 and 5 x 6 = 30) and then add them together (60 + 30 = 90).
- The Doubling and Halving Strategy: You can halve the 6 to get 3 and double the 15 to get 30. Then, simply multiply 30 by 3, which is significantly easier to calculate mentally and results in 90.
- The Repeated Addition Approach: 15 + 15 = 30, 30 + 15 = 45, 45 + 15 = 60, 60 + 15 = 75, 75 + 15 = 90.

Practical Applications in Daily Life
You might wonder why focusing on a specific product like 15 Times 6 is helpful outside of a school setting. The reality is that we encounter these types of multiples constantly. For instance, if you are planning a small event and need to buy party favors, knowing that you need 6 packages of items that come in sets of 15 means you are dealing with a total of 90 items. Being able to compute this instantly allows for quicker shopping and better inventory management.
Consider the following scenarios where this level of arithmetic proves essential:
- Time Management: If a task takes 15 minutes to complete and you have 6 such tasks on your list, you know that you need exactly 90 minutes, or 1.5 hours, to finish everything.
- Budgeting: If you are setting aside 15 dollars per week for a specific goal, calculating 15 Times 6 tells you exactly how much you will have saved after six weeks: 90 dollars.
- Culinary Ratios: When scaling a recipe, if a single serving requires 15 grams of an ingredient, and you are hosting 6 guests, you quickly determine that you need 90 grams in total.
